1.1 Local Network Remote Control

Remote control apps often need Local Network permission so an iPhone or iPad can discover and communicate with a Mac, Windows PC, TV, or streaming device on the same Wi-Fi network. 2. Reporting a Security Vulnerability

If you believe you have discovered a security issue affecting our website or mobile applications, please report it responsibly through one of the following channels:

To help us investigate efficiently, include:

  • A description of the issue.
  • Steps to reproduce the vulnerability.
  • Any relevant technical details or screenshots.
  • Your contact information (optional).

3. Responsible Disclosure Guidelines

We ask that you:

  • Do not publicly disclose the issue before we have addressed it.
  • Avoid violating the privacy of our users.
  • Avoid accessing or modifying data that does not belong to you.
  • Refrain from any activity that disrupts our services.

We pledge to:

  • Acknowledge your report promptly.
  • Investigate and validate the issue.
  • Notify you when a fix has been deployed.
  • Credit you publicly (if you wish) on a future acknowledgments page.

4. Out of Scope

The following items are generally outside the scope of this security policy:

  • UI/UX bugs.
  • Non-security-related crashes or performance issues.
  • Reports without sufficient detail to reproduce.
  • Issues affecting third-party platforms (e.g., Apple App Store, Google Play).

5. Safe Harbor

If you follow the guidelines above and act in good faith, we will consider your actions authorized and will not pursue legal action.

Security FAQ

Do the apps expose my computer or TV to the internet?

Remote control features are designed around local network pairing and nearby device control. They are not intended to expose your computer or TV to the public internet.

What should I do if I see an unexpected pairing request?

Do not approve it. Confirm that the request comes from your own device and that you are on a trusted network.
